Readability in Real Business Settings
One of the biggest concerns when choosing a creative font is whether it remains legible. Fishora performs well in most contexts, but it’s important to test it in real-world scenarios before finalizing your brand materials:
- Small Print: Avoid using Fishora for tiny text, like fine print on packaging or legal disclaimers. Save it for larger, more visible areas.
- Mobile Screens: Ensure the font scales well on mobile devices. Test it on your website or app to see if it stays clear and easy to read.
- Printed Materials: Try printing sample designs on different surfaces (like glossy paper or fabric) to confirm that Fishora maintains its clarity and impact.
- Social Media Thumbnails: Since many users scroll quickly, check how the font appears in smaller thumbnail sizes. You don’t want your message to get lost.

Commercial Licensing for Fishora
Before using Fishora in your commercial font projects, always verify the licensing terms. Many fonts have restrictions on usage in digital downloads, merchandise, or client work. Make sure you purchase the appropriate license that covers all the ways you plan to use the font, including in your product labels, templates, and marketing campaigns. This step protects your business and ensures you’re compliant with font usage laws.
